RNCM Festival on Radio 3

Highlights of this year's RNCM Festival of Brass from Manchester are to be broadcast on BBC Radio 3 next week.

rncm
 

Black Dyke Band and The Venezuelen Brass Ensemble are to be featured on BBC Radio 3 next week as highlights are broadcast of the RNCM Festival of Brass which took place in Manchester in January.

Afternoon on 3

Radio 3's 'Afternoon on 3' is an integral part of the station's weekday schedule and is designed to showcase music from varying genre's and concerts that have taken place and starting on Monday 28th February at 4.20pm, the programme will feature performances from the festival throughout the week.

Dyke Monday and Tuesday

Black Dyke conducted by Dr Nicholas Childs who opened the Festival will be featured on Monday and Tuesday. Dyke's programme includes the first performance of Paul Lovatt-Cooper's 'Starburst and Canyons' along with Philip Wilby's 'Red Priest' whilst Richard Marshall is the featured trumpet soloist in Arthur Butterworth's 'Concerto alla Veneziana'.

Twenty four hours later, actor Barrie Rutter is the narrator in William Walton's film score to 'Richard III' whilst Dyke's contribution to the week closes with Bourgeois's dramatic work, 'Blitz'.

Undoubted highlight

The high point of the RNCM Festival was the performance of the Venezuelen Brass Ensemble at The Bridgewater Hall and they will be featured on Wednesday and Friday.

Once again Radio 3 will broadcast highlights from the RNCM with the Venezuelen Brass Ensemble performances being something you'll just want to sit back and hear — they are simply breathtaking4BR


Unforgettable

On Wednesday 2nd March listener's will get the chance to hear Giancarlo Castro's 'Gran Fanfaria' followed by what was a stunning interpretation of Bernstein's 'Symphonic Dances' from West Side Story arranged by Eric Crees.

Breathtaking Mussorgsky to close

To conclude the week's music from the RNCM Festival is the Venezuelen Brass Ensemble's performance of Elgar Howarth's arrangement of Mussorgsky's 'Pictures at an Exhibition' which brought many in the hall to their feet at its conclusion — it really is something not to be missed!!

'Afternoon on 3' is available online in addition to being available via the BBC iplayer after transmission.
